Mozilla Firefox 3.0 comes with "Smart Bookmarks Folders". These folders work like saved searches and update automatically. If you don't know about them, then click on "Bookmarks" menu and you'll see following 3 smart bookmarks folders along with your other custom bookmarks:
- Most Visited
- Recently Bookmarked
- Recent Tags

Many times people delete these default smart bookmarks folder by mistake or intentionally to customize the bookmarks menu and toolbar. If you have also deleted these 3 folders but want to get them back, then this simple tutorial will help you.
Just follow these easy steps to get the default "Smart Bookmarks Folders" back in Firefox:
1. Open Firefox and type about:config in the addressbar and press Enter. It’ll confirm, click on I’ll be careful, I promise! button.
2. Now type smart in the Filter box. It’ll show following entry:
browser.places.smartBookmarksVersion
3. Double-click on it or right-click on it and select "Modify", now set its value to 0

4. That's it. Now restart Firefox and all 3 default Smart Bookmarks folders will be back.
